Exploring the Masterpiece: Rocky Seashore by Gustave Courbet

Historical Context of Rocky Seashore: A Glimpse into 19th Century France

The Realism Movement: Courbet's Role in Art History

Gustave Courbet, a pivotal figure in the Realism movement, painted "Rocky Seashore" in 1869. This period marked a shift from romanticism to a focus on everyday life and nature. Courbet's commitment to depicting reality challenged traditional artistic conventions. He sought to portray the world as he saw it, emphasizing authenticity over idealization. His work laid the groundwork for future movements, influencing artists like Édouard Manet and the Impressionists.

Influences of Nature and Landscape in Courbet's Work

Courbet's fascination with nature is evident in "Rocky Seashore." He often drew inspiration from the rugged landscapes of his native France, particularly the Normandy coast. The interplay of light and shadow in his landscapes reflects his deep appreciation for the natural world. Courbet believed that nature was a source of truth, and he aimed to capture its raw beauty in his paintings. This connection to the environment resonates throughout his oeuvre, making him a key figure in landscape painting.

Visual Analysis: The Elements of Rocky Seashore

Color Palette: The Vibrant Blues and Earthy Tones

The color palette of "Rocky Seashore" features vibrant blues that evoke the vastness of the ocean. Earthy tones of browns and greens ground the composition, representing the rocky cliffs and lush vegetation. This harmonious blend of colors creates a sense of depth and realism. Courbet's use of color not only captures the scene's beauty but also conveys the emotional weight of the landscape.

Brushwork Techniques: Impasto and Textural Depth

Courbet employed impasto techniques in "Rocky Seashore," applying thick layers of paint to create texture. This method adds a tactile quality to the artwork, inviting viewers to engage with the surface. The dynamic brushstrokes convey movement, mimicking the crashing waves and shifting clouds. This textural depth enhances the viewer's experience, making the scene feel alive and immersive.

Composition: The Balance of Land, Sea, and Sky

The composition of "Rocky Seashore" masterfully balances land, sea, and sky. The rocky cliffs rise dramatically from the ocean, while the expansive sky looms overhead. This triadic structure draws the viewer's eye across the canvas, creating a sense of movement and harmony. Courbet's careful arrangement of elements reflects his understanding of natural forms and their relationships.

Comparative Analysis: Rocky Seashore and Other Works by Courbet

Contrasting Landscapes: From The Stone Breakers to The Wave

When comparing "Rocky Seashore" to other works like "The Stone Breakers" and "The Wave," distinct contrasts emerge. While "The Stone Breakers" focuses on labor and human struggle, "Rocky Seashore" emphasizes the beauty of nature. Each painting reflects Courbet's diverse interests, showcasing his ability to capture different aspects of life.
